"Fine-Arts" prints on paper
It is a process of printing on art paper using very high-quality pigment inks and printed in very high definition. Its level of conservation is exceptional (more than 100 years), its quality, depth, and richness of nuances exceeds the classic photo print on Argentic paper.

Glossy finish
Apart from its exceptional thickness, the fiber paper is composed of an alpha-cellulose base without acid and it is covered with barium sulphate, and a microporous layer absorption enhancing pigments during printing. A pure white color, non-yellowing to light, this paper is especially designed for resistance and aging. It is used by major museums worldwide as it offers excellent resolution, rendering deep and dense colors.

Marco Abbamondi, born in Naples on June 7, 1974. Extrovert and communicative, as many Neapolitans are, I like to describe myself as an ‘’instinctive artist’’, very careful to the world around me.
My "adventure" in the world of arts began in 1999 when I felt the need to express my point of view. My work aims at expressing an idea of art as a mix of "culture and energy". Travelling often inside and outside Europe, I am a careful observer of uses, customs and above all architectures around me.
After producing small wooden works inspired by Naples’ architectures and colours, I decide to widen my artistic horizons, expanding from the Neapolitan tradition to contemporary art. One of the best examples of my personal mix of ‘’old and new’’ is a post-modern version of Neapolitan classic Crib. My works are not necessarily connected to a traditional style, but inspired to solutions dictated from freedom of shapes mixed to sounds, games of lights, images, ancient and modern elements.
